passing text through link?
Is there any way that I could pass some text through a link from a site that I own to a site that we don't... basically there is a text box on a page that wants the visitor to enter a promotional code.. Well since they would be linking from our site we wanted our promotional code to go in the box when they click the link on our site.. I have tried a few things and nothing works.. I am not even sure it is possible. Here is the site so you can see it
http://accounting.epowerc.net:8181/signup/signup.asp
and our promotional code is MIDW01

Re: passing text through link?
Unless their ASP is explicitly looking for a value to be passed through either a GET or POST method, then no, there is nothing that you can do.
